Default Custom clothes and hair not working with summer and winter clothing
I'm sure some of you are aware that when you are in CAS and you get to the outfits portion of the character creation that custom clothes and hair don't seem to work with the summer and winter outfits. Is there a fix for this I'm not familiar with yet? Maybe a work-a-round? Any help would be appreciated.

Well, you can either remove the warm/cold filtering tag and choose whatever you want
or use Sims4Studio to batch-fix all the cc so it gets included in these categories..
but as someone mentioned around here before, some of it might get tagged to the wrong category (warm cloths to cold, and vise versa) if you use the batch-fix

I personally think that the easiest way is to remove the filtering tag.
